A plant genus of the family ASCLEPIADACEAE. Members contain pregnane glycosides (marsdekoiside & marstomentosides, maryal) and hainaneosides (SAPONINS).

Two new C21 steroidal glycosides from Marsdenia tenacissima (ROXB.) WIGHT et ARN. (1/3)

Two new C(21) steroidal glycosides, tenacissoside L (1), tenacissoside M (2), were isolated from the stems of Marsdenia tenacissima (ROXB.) WIGHT et ARN. Their structures were elucidated, respectively, by means of chemical and spectral data, including ESI-MS, HR-ESI-MS, 1D-NMR and 2D-NMR.  (+info)

Fingerprinting of Marsdenia tenacissima by capillary electrophoresis compared to HPLC. (2/3)

Capillary electrophoresis (CE) is employed for the first time in a fingerprint analysis of Marsdenia tenacissima. Because the CE method is a new approach to fingerprinting, it is necessary to compare it to the conventional one: high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C). In HPLC separation, 15 components are separated in 55 min, while in CE separation, 10 stable components are separated by 200 mM boric acid (pH 8.0) containing 10% methanol within 12 min. CE shows better performance in the analysis of Marsdenia tenacissima, which makes its fingerprint in a much lower analysis time than with HPLC. It is further proven that CE can be a feasible and cost-effective method for the development of the fingerprint of Marsdenia tenacissima.  (+info)

"Marsdenia" is not a term that has a widely accepted medical definition. It is the name of a genus of plants in the family Apocynaceae, also known as the dogbane family. Some species of Marsdenia contain compounds with potential medicinal properties, and there has been some research into their use in treating various conditions such as cancer, HIV, and inflammation. However, more research is needed before these uses can be considered established medical facts.
